The Rolls-Royce Interview Loop

Your onsite loop will typically consist of 5 rounds.

  1. 1

    Round 1

    Recruiter Screen
    Motivation, operations background, supply chain interest.
  2. 2

    Round 2

    Operations Case
    End-to-end supply chain optimization, bottleneck diagnosis, network design.
  3. 3

    Round 3

    Forecasting & Planning
    Demand planning, S&OP, inventory optimization, working with statistical and ML forecasts.
  4. 4

    Round 4

    Optimization
    Linear programming intuition, route optimization, facility location, trade-offs between cost/service/CO2.
  5. 5

    Round 5

    Behavioral / Leadership
    Past evidence of ownership, influence, resolving conflict.

The Danger Zone: Top Reasons Candidates Fail

Based on our database of Rolls-Royce interview outcomes, avoid these common traps:

  • Ignoring the criticality and demand variability of different components.
  • Confusing shadow price with the actual cost of the resource.
  • Jumping to solutions without a structured diagnostic process.
  • Underestimating the impact of supply chain resilience and risk factors.

Test Yourself: Real Rolls-Royce Questions

Three real prompts pulled from our database.

Type · Network Design

If Rolls-Royce were to establish a new regional distribution hub for spare parts in Asia, what key factors would you consider in determining its optimal location and capacity?

Type · Ownership

At Rolls-Royce, we operate under rigorous airworthiness and safety standards that often extend deep into our sub-tier supply base. Describe a time you discovered a quality or compliance inconsistency at a supplier that sat outside your immediate procurement scope but threatened the integrity of our engine components. How did you escalate this and ensure the necessary corrective actions were taken to protect our safety standards?

Type · End-to-End Optimization

Imagine a disruption in the supply of a critical component for our Trent engine family. Walk me through how you would diagnose the root cause and what immediate actions you'd propose to mitigate the impact on production and customer service.
